About Cinderella
Walt Disney's 1950 animated masterpiece 'Cinderella' remains one of the most cherished fairy tales in cinematic history. This enchanting film tells the story of a kind-hearted young woman forced into servitude by her cruel stepmother and stepsisters. When the King announces a Royal Ball to find a bride for his son, Cinderella's dreams of attending seem impossible until her Fairy Godmother appears, transforming rags into a magnificent gown and a pumpkin into a golden coach.
The film's animation showcases Disney at its peak, with beautifully detailed backgrounds and character designs that have stood the test of time. Ilene Woods provides the perfect voice for Cinderella, capturing both her vulnerability and inner strength. The supporting characters, particularly the lovable mice Gus and Jaq, add warmth and humor to the story, while the wicked stepmother Lady Tremaine remains one of Disney's most compelling villains.
Beyond its visual splendor, 'Cinderella' features memorable songs like 'A Dream Is a Wish Your Heart Makes' and 'Bibbidi-Bobbidi-Boo' that have become Disney standards. The film's message about maintaining hope and kindness despite adversity continues to resonate with audiences of all ages.
